There's one weird number that might explain Bernie Sanders' West Virginia win

BusinessInsider.com 

Associated Press/John Minchillo

You know who may have helped pull Bernie Sanders over the top to victory in Tuesday’s West Virginia primary? Donald Trump voters, that’s who. 

That’s what exit poll data from NBC indicates, in any case.

About one-third of the West Virginia Democrats who cast ballots on Tuesday say they plan to vote for Mr. Trump in November, according to NBC’s data.

By a wide margin those voters picked Senator Sanders over Hillary Clinton.
